OBJECTIVE: Built environment interventions provide structural solutions to complex urban challenges. Though community voices are part of municipal decision-making, planners and public health professionals need tools to better integrate their perspectives for desired changes (what) when implementing built environment interventions (how). We present two simultaneous concept mapping exercises conducted in Montréal, Canada, to facilitate the consideration of these dimensions. METHODS: Community members were prompted about neighbourhood changes that could improve their quality of life; stakeholders were prompted about factors that contribute to successful implementation of interventions. Through each exercise, items were generated, grouped, and rated on importance and feasibility. Concept maps were produced using multidimensional scaling and hierarchical cluster analysis. The clusters identified by community members and stakeholders were combined into a Community × Stakeholder Matrix, which supported discussions on interventions with the research's Advisory Committee. RESULTS: Thirty-two community members generated 41 responses, which resulted in 6 clusters: (1) strengthen public transportation, (2) reduce space dedicated to cars, (3) foster local social connections, (4) develop quality cycling infrastructure, (5) improve pedestrian accessibility, and (6) green the city. Thirty-seven stakeholders generated 40 items, which resulted in 5 clusters: (1) collaboration with stakeholders and citizens, (2) planning and evaluation, (3) common vision for the future, (4) regulatory framework and funding, and (5) context-informed approach. CONCLUSION: Capturing the collective vision of our urban environments and the processes underlying change through concept mapping can lead to more successful changes. We propose combining understandings of the what and how into a matrix to support evaluation and strategic planning of interventions and better integrate community voices into operational planning.

INTRODUCTION: Improving sustainable transportation options will help cities tackle growing challenges related to population health, congestion, climate change and inequity. Interventions supporting active transportation face many practical and political hurdles. Implementation science aims to understand how interventions or policies arise, how they can be translated to new contexts or scales and who benefits. Sustainable transportation interventions are complex, and existing implementation science frameworks may not be suitable. To apply and adapt implementation science for healthy cities, we have launched our mixed-methods research programme, CapaCITY/É. We aim to understand how, why and for whom sustainable transportation interventions are successful and when they are not. METHODS AND ANALYSIS: Across nine Canadian municipalities and the State of Victoria (Australia), our research will focus on two types of sustainable transportation interventions: all ages and abilities bicycle networks and motor vehicle speed management interventions. We will (1) document the implementation process and outcomes of both types of sustainable transportation interventions; (2) examine equity, health and mobility impacts of these interventions; (3) advance implementation science by developing a novel sustainable transportation implementation science framework and (4) develop tools for scaling up and scaling out sustainable transportation interventions. Training activities will develop interdisciplinary scholars and practitioners able to work at the nexus of academia and sustainable cities. ETHICS AND DISSEMINATION: This study received approval from the Simon Fraser University Office of Ethics Research (H22-03469). A Knowledge Mobilization Hub will coordinate dissemination of findings via a website; presentations to academic, community organisations and practitioner audiences; and through peer-reviewed articles.

Urban environmental factors such as air quality, heat islands, and access to greenspaces and community amenities impact public health. Some vulnerable populations such as low-income groups, children, older adults, new immigrants, and visible minorities live in areas with fewer beneficial conditions, and therefore, face greater health risks. Planning and advocating for equitable healthy urban environments requires systematic analysis of reliable spatial data to identify where vulnerable populations intersect with positive or negative urban/environmental characteristics. To facilitate this effort in Canada, we developed HealthyPlan.City ( https://healthyplan.city/ ), a freely available web mapping platform for users to visualize the spatial patterns of built environment indicators, vulnerable populations, and environmental inequity within over 125 Canadian cities. This tool helps users identify areas within Canadian cities where relatively higher proportions of vulnerable populations experience lower than average levels of beneficial environmental conditions, which we refer to as Equity priority areas. Using nationally standardized environmental data from satellite imagery and other large geospatial databases and demographic data from the Canadian Census, HealthyPlan.City provides a block-by-block snapshot of environmental inequities in Canadian cities. The tool aims to support urban planners, public health professionals, policy makers, and community organizers to identify neighborhoods where targeted investments and improvements to the local environment would simultaneously help communities address environmental inequities, promote public health, and adapt to climate change. In this paper, we report on the key considerations that informed our approach to developing this tool and describe the current web-based application.

Background: Cycling infrastructure investments support active transportation, improve population health, and reduce health inequities. This study examines the relationship between changes in cycling infrastructure (2011-2016) and census tract (CT)-level measures of material deprivation, visible minorities, and gentrification in Montreal. Methods: Our outcomes are the length of protected bike lanes, cyclist-only paths, multi-use paths, and on-street bike lanes in 2011, and change in total length of bike lanes between 2011 and 2016 at the CT level. Census data provided measures of the level of material deprivation and of the percentage of visible minorities in 2011, and if a CT gentrified between 2011 and 2016. Using a hurdle modeling approach, we explore associations among these CT-level socioeconomic measures, gentrification status, baseline cycling infrastructure (2011), and its changes (2011-2016). We further tested if these associations varied depending on the baseline level of existing infrastructure, to assess if areas with originally less resources benefited less or more. Results: In 2011, CTs with higher level of material deprivation or greater percentages of visible minorities had less cycling infrastructure. Overall, between 2011 and 2016, cycling infrastructure increased from 7.0% to 10.9% of the road network, but the implementation of new cycling infrastructure in CTs with no pre-existing cycling infrastructure in 2011 was less likely to occur in CTs with a higher percentage of visible minorities. High-income CTs that were ineligible for gentrification between 2011 and 2016 benefited less from new cycling infrastructure implementations compared to low-income CTs that were not gentrified during the same period. Conclusion: Montreal's municipal cycling infrastructure programs did not exacerbate socioeconomic disparities in cycling infrastructure from 2011 to 2016 in CTs with pre-existing infrastructure. However, it is crucial to prioritize the implementation of cycling infrastructure in CTs with high populations of visible minorities, particularly in CTs where no cycling infrastructure currently exists.

BACKGROUND: Social network analysis (SNA) is often used to examine how social relationships influence adolescent health behaviours, but no study has documented the range of network measures used to do so. We aimed to identify network measures used in studies on adolescent health behaviours. METHODS: We conducted a systematic review to identify network measures in studies investigating adolescent health behaviours with SNA. Measures were grouped into eight categories based on network concepts commonly described in the literature: popularity, position within the network, network density, similarity, nature of relationships, peer behaviours, social norms, and selection and influence mechanisms. Different subcategories were further identified. We detailed all distinct measures and the labels used to name them in included articles. RESULTS: Out of 6686 articles screened, 201 were included. The categories most frequently investigated were peer behaviours (n=201, 100%), position within the network (n=144, 71.6%) and popularity (n=110, 54.7%). The number of measurement methods varied from 1 for 'similarity on popularity' (within the 'similarity' category) to 28 for the 'characterisation of the relationship between the respondent and nominated peers' (within the 'nature of the relationships' category). Using the examples of 'social isolation', 'group membership', 'individuals in a central position' (within the 'position within the network' category) and 'nominations of influential peers' (sub within the 'popularity' category), we illustrated the inconsistent reporting and heterogeneity in measurement methods and semantics. CONCLUSION: Robust methodological recommendations are needed to harmonise network measures in order to facilitate comparison across studies and optimise public health intervention based on SNA.

OBJECTIVE: To summarize findings from qualitative studies on factors associated with smoking cessation among adolescents and young adults. DATA SOURCES: We searched Pubmed, Psychinfo, CINAHL, Embase, Web of Science, and SCOPUS databases, as well as reference lists, for peer-reviewed articles published in English or French between January 1, 2000, and November 18, 2020. We used keywords such as adolescents, determinants, cessation, smoking, and qualitative methods. STUDY SELECTION: Of 1724 records identified, we included 39 articles that used qualitative or mixed methods, targeted adolescents and young adults aged 10-24, and aimed to identify factors associated with smoking cessation or smoking reduction. DATA EXTRACTION: Two authors independently extracted the data using a standardized form. We assessed study quality using the National Institute for Health and Care Excellence checklist for qualitative studies. DATA SYNTHESIS: We used an aggregative meta-synthesis approach and identified 39 conceptually distinct factors associated with smoking cessation. We grouped them into two categories: (1) environmental factors [tobacco control policies, pro-smoking norms, smoking cessation services and interventions, influence of friends and family], and (2) individual attributes (psychological characteristics, attitudes, pre-quitting smoking behavior, nicotine dependence symptoms, and other substances use). We developed a synthetic framework that captured the factors identified, the links that connect them, and their associations with smoking cessation. CONCLUSIONS: This qualitative synthesis offers new insights on factors related to smoking cessation services, interventions, and attitudes about cessation (embarrassment when using cessation services) not reported in quantitative reviews, supplementing limited evidence for developing cessation programs for young persons who smoke. IMPLICATIONS: Using an aggregative meta-synthesis approach, this study identified 39 conceptually distinct factors grouped into two categories: Environmental factors and individual attributes. These findings highlight the importance of considering both environmental and individual factors when developing smoking cessation programs for young persons who smoke. The study also sheds light on self-conscious emotions towards cessation, such as embarrassment when using cessation services, which are often overlooked in quantitative reviews. Overall, this study has important implications for developing effective smoking cessation interventions and policies that address the complex factors influencing smoking behavior among young persons.

In this study, we compared location data from a dedicated Global Positioning System (GPS) device with location data from smartphones. Data from the Interventions, Equity, and Action in Cities Team (INTERACT) Study, a study examining the impact of urban-form changes on health in 4 Canadian cities (Victoria, Vancouver, Saskatoon, and Montreal), were used. A total of 337 participants contributed data collected for about 6 months from the Ethica Data smartphone application (Ethica Data Inc., Toronto, Ontario, Canada) and the SenseDoc dedicated GPS (MobySens Technologies Inc., Montreal, Quebec, Canada) during the period 2017-2019. Participants recorded an average total of 14,781 Ethica locations (standard deviation, 19,353) and 197,167 SenseDoc locations (standard deviation, 111,868). Dynamic time warping and cross-correlation were used to examine the spatial and temporal similarity of GPS points. Four activity-space measures derived from the smartphone app and the dedicated GPS device were compared. Analysis showed that cross-correlations were above 0.8 at the 125-m resolution for the survey and day levels and increased as cell size increased. At the day or survey level, there were only small differences between the activity-space measures. Based on our findings, we recommend dedicated GPS devices for studies where the exposure and the outcome are both measured at high frequency and when the analysis will not be aggregate. When the exposure and outcome are measured or will be aggregated to the day level, the dedicated GPS device and the smartphone app provide similar results.

BACKGROUND: Cannabis legalization in some U.S.A. states has catapulted the mass production of concentrates, with tetrahydrocannabinol (THC) concentrations ranging from 50-90%. A major public health concern is that these products will increase cannabis-related harms such as use disorders, psychotic symptoms, and accidental poisonings. This paper describes and contextualizes the results of a study requested by the WA State Legislature to understand perspectives of WA stakeholders on the topic. METHODS: Concept Mapping (CM), a mixed-methods research approach that supports people-centered policy decisions was utilized. The goal of the study was to explore stakeholders' concern levels and support of policies to address the availability of high THC cannabis products. For analysis purposes, stakeholders were categorized into three groups: community, professionals, and cannabis advocates. RESULTS: CM generated an inventory of policy ideas for regulating high-potency cannabis from a variety of stakeholders. Notably, stakeholders from community and professional groups supported environmental policy changes such as such as taxation, increasing minimum age for high concentration cannabis products, and advertising prohibition. Meanwhile, cannabis advocates (mostly industry actors) opposed taxation per THC content, proposed lowering taxes, and supported policies with low population impact such as educating parents, teachers, and youth. CONCLUSION: Support for regulating high concentration THC products varied by stakeholder group. Consistent with how other health compromising industries have historically acted, cannabis industry stakeholders rejected regulation of their products. Future studies should explore non-cannabis industry stakeholders' willingness to work towards minimizing the influence of the cannabis industry in policy development processes to assure public health regulations prevail.

BACKGROUND: With the advent of the COVID-19 pandemic, in-person social interactions and opportunities for accessing resources that sustain health and well-being have drastically reduced. We therefore designed the pan-Canadian prospective COVID-19: HEalth and Social Inequities across Neighbourhoods (COHESION) cohort to provide a deeper understanding of how the COVID-19 pandemic context affects mental health and well-being, key determinants of health, and health inequities. METHODS: This paper presents the design of the two-phase COHESION Study, and descriptive results from the first phase conducted between May 2020 and September 2021. During that period, the COHESION research platform collected monthly data linked to COVID-19 such as infection and vaccination status, perceptions and attitudes regarding pandemic-related measures, and information on participants' physical and mental health, well-being, sleep, loneliness, resilience, substances use, living conditions, social interactions, activities, and mobility. RESULTS: The 1,268 people enrolled in the Phase 1 COHESION Study are for the most part from Ontario (47%) and Quebec (33%), aged 48 ± 16 years [mean ± standard deviation (SD)], and mainly women (78%), White (85%), with a university degree (63%), and living in large urban centers (70%). According to the 298 ± 68 (mean ± SD) prospective questionnaires completed each month on average, the first year of follow-up reveals significant temporal variations in standardized indexes of well-being, loneliness, anxiety, depression, and psychological distress. CONCLUSIONS: The COHESION Study will allow identifying trajectories of mental health and well-being while investigating their determinants and how these may vary by subgroup, over time, and across different provinces in Canada, in varying context including the pandemic recovery period. Our findings will contribute valuable insights to the urban health field and inform future public health interventions.

The 20-min neighbourhood (20MN) concept aims to enable residents to meet daily needs using resources within a 20-min trip from home noting that there is no single definition of what services and amenities are required for daily needs nor what modes of transport constitute a 20 min trip. Whether 20MNs promote better health and whether associations differ by socio-economic status (SES) is unknown. Using cross-sectional data from adults randomly sampled in 2018-19 from Melbourne or Adelaide, Australia, we examined whether associations between neighbourhood type (20MN/non-20MN) and diet, physical activity or self-rated health vary according to individual- or area-level SES. We found no consistent patterns of interactions. The results do not consistently support the often assumed belief that 20MNs support more healthful behaviour and that these relationships vary by SES.

The urban environment plays an important role for the mental health of residents. Researchers mainly focus on residential neighbourhoods as exposure context, leaving aside the effects of non-residential environments. In order to consider the daily experience of urban spaces, a people-based approach focused on mobility paths is needed. Applying this approach, (1) this study investigated whether individuals' momentary mental well-being is related to the exposure to micro-urban spaces along the daily mobility paths within the two previous hours; (2) it explored whether these associations differ when environmental exposures are defined considering all location points or only outdoor location points; and (3) it examined the associations between the types of activity and mobility and momentary depressive symptomatology. Using a geographically-explicit ecological momentary assessment approach (GEMA), momentary depressive symptomatology of 216 older adults living in the Ile-de-France region was assessed using smartphone surveys, while participants were tracked with a GPS receiver and an accelerometer for seven days. Exposure to multiple elements of the streetscape was computed within a street network buffer of 25 m of each GPS point over the two hours prior to the questionnaire. Mobility and activity type were documented from a GPS-based mobility survey. We estimated Bayesian generalized mixed effect models with random effects at the individual and day levels and took into account time autocorrelation. We also estimated fixed effects. A better momentary mental wellbeing was observed when residents performed leisure activities or were involved in active mobility and when they were exposed to walkable areas (pedestrian dedicated paths, open spaces, parks and green areas), water elements, and commerce, leisure and cultural attractors over the previous two hours. These relationships were stronger when exposures were defined based only on outdoor location points rather than all location points, and when we considered within-individual differences compared to between-individual differences.

BACKGROUND: Striking geographic variations in prostate cancer incidence suggest an aetiological role for spatially-distributed factors. We assessed whether neighbourhood social deprivation, which can reflect limited social contacts, unfavourable lifestyle and environmental exposures, is associated with prostate cancer risk. METHODS: In 2005-2012, we recruited 1931 incident prostate cancer cases and 1994 controls in a case-control study in Montreal, Canada. Lifetime residential addresses were linked to an area-based social deprivation index around recruitment (2006) and about 10 years earlier (1996). Logistic regression estimated adjusted odds ratios (ORs) and 95% confidence intervals (CIs). RESULTS: Men residing in areas characterised by greater social deprivation had elevated prostate cancer risks (ORs of 1.54 and 1.60 for recent and past exposures, respectively; highest vs lowest quintiles), independently from area- and individual-level confounders and screening patterns. The increase in risk with recent high social deprivation was particularly elevated for high-grade prostate cancer at diagnosis (OR 1.87, 95% CI 1.32-2.64). Associations were more pronounced for neighbourhoods with higher proportions of separated/divorced or widowed individuals in the past, and with higher percentages of residents living alone recently. CONCLUSIONS: These novel findings, suggesting that neighbourhood-level social deprivation increases the risk of prostate cancer, point out to potential targeted public health interventions.

While census-defined measures of gentrification are often used in research on gentrification and health, surveys can be used to better understand how residents perceive neighborhood change, and the implications for mental health. Whether or not gentrification affects mental health may depend on the extent to which an individual perceives changes in their neighborhood. Using health and map-based survey data, collected from 2020 to 2021, from the Interventions, Research, and Action in Cities Team, we examined links between perceptions of neighborhood change, census-defined neighborhood gentrification at participant residential addresses, and mental health among 505 adults living in Montréal. After adjusting for age, gender, race, education, and duration at current residence, greater perceived affordability and more positive feelings about neighborhood changes were associated with better mental health, as measured by the mental health component of the short-form health survey. Residents who perceived more change to the social environment had lower mental health scores, after adjusting individual covariates. Census-defined gentrification was not significantly associated with mental health, and perceptions of neighborhood change did not significantly modify the effect of gentrification on mental health. Utilizing survey tools can help researchers understand the role that perceptions of neighborhood change play in the understanding how neighborhood change impacts mental health.

Introduction: COVID-19 has impacted millions of commuters by decreasing their mobility and transport patterns. While these changes in travel have been studied, less is known about how commute changes may have impacted individuals' body mass index (BMI). The present longitudinal study explores the relationship between commute mode and BMI of employed individuals in Montréal, Canada. Methods: This study uses panel data drawn from two waves of the Montréal Mobility Survey (MMS) conducted before and during the COVID-19 pandemic (n = 458). BMI was modeled separately for women and men as a function of commuting mode, WalkScore©, sociodemographic, and behavioral covariates using a multilevel regression modeling approach. Results: For women, BMI significantly increased during the COVID-19 pandemic, but telecommuting frequency, and more specifically telecommuting as a replacement of driving, led to a statistically significant decrease in BMI. For men, higher levels of residential local accessibility decreased BMI, while telecommuting did not have a statistically significant effect on BMI. Conclusions: This study's findings confirm previously observed gendered differences in the relations between the built environment, transport behaviors, and BMI, while offering new insights regarding the impacts of the changes in commute patterns linked to the COVID-19 pandemic. Since some of the COVID-19 impacts on commute are expected to be lasting, findings from this research can be of use by health and transport practitioners as they work towards generating policies that improve population health.

Interest is growing in neighborhood effects on health beyond individual's home locations. However, few studies accounted for selective daily mobility bias. Selective mobility of 470 older adults (aged 67-94) living in urban and suburban areas of Luxembourg, was measured through detour percentage between their observed GPS-based paths and their shortest paths. Multilevel negative binomial regression tested associations between detour percentage, trips characteristics and environmental exposures. Detour percentage was higher for walking trips (28%) than car trips (16%). Low-speed areas and connectivity differences between observed and shortest paths vary by transport mode, indicating a potential selective daily mobility bias. The positive effects of amenities, street connectivity, low-speed areas and greenness on walking detour reinforce the existing evidence on older adults' active transportation. Urban planning interventions favoring active transportation will also promote walking trips with longer detours, helping older adults to increase their physical activity levels and ultimately promote healthy aging.

PURPOSE: Our objectives were (i) to systematically review how SNA is used in studies investigating adolescent health behaviours (i.e., the purpose of using SNA, methods used for network data collection and analysis), and (ii) to develop methodological guidelines to help researchers use SNA in studies on adolescent health behaviours. METHODS: Five databases were searched using keywords related to "social network analysis" and "adolescents". We extracted data from included articles pertaining to the choice of methods for network data collection and analysis. We used these data to develop a 5-step decision tree to help researchers make methodological decisions most appropriate to their research objectives. RESULTS: A total of 201 articles were included. Most investigated tobacco (50%) or alcohol use (48%). SNA was used most often to examine processes related to peer selection or influence (37%) and/or to examine the effect of sociometric position on health behaviours (34%). 181 studies (90%) used a sociocentric approach for SNA, 16 studies (8%) used an egocentric approach, and 4 studies (2%) used both. We identified five decision-making steps in SNA including the choice of: (i) network boundary, (ii) SNA approach, (iii) methods for name generators, (iv) methods for name interpreters, and (iv) SNA indicators. CONCLUSION: This study provides insights and guidance in a 5-step decision tree on practical and methodological considerations in using SNA to explore adolescent health behaviours.

New 'big data' streams such as street-level imagery are offering unprecedented possibilities for developing health-relevant data on the urban environment. Urban environmental features derived from street-level imagery have been used to assess pedestrian-friendly neighbourhood design and to predict active commuting, but few such studies have been conducted in Canada. Using 1.15 million Google Street View (GSV) images in seven Canadian cities, we applied image segmentation and object detection computer vision methods to extract data on persons, bicycles, buildings, sidewalks, open sky (without trees or buildings), and vegetation at postal codes. The associations between urban features and walk-to-work rates obtained from the Canadian Census were assessed. We also assessed how GSV-derived urban features perform in predicting walk-to-work rates relative to more widely used walkability measures. Results showed that features derived from street-level images are better able to predict the percent of people walking to work as their primary mode of transportation compared to data derived from traditional walkability metrics. Given the increasing coverage of street-level imagery around the world, there is considerable potential for machine learning and computer vision to help researchers study patterns of active transportation and other health-related behaviours and exposures.

BACKGROUND: Built and social environments are associated with physical activity. Global Positioning Systems (GPS) and accelerometer data can capture how people move through their environments and provide promising tools to better understand associations between environmental characteristics and physical activity. The purpose of this study is to examine the associations between GPS-derived exposure to built environment and gentrification characteristics and accelerometer-measured physical activity in a sample of adults across four cities. METHODS: We used wave 1 data from the Interventions, Research, and Action in Cities Team, a cohort of adults living in the Canadian cities of Victoria, Vancouver, Saskatoon, and Montreal. A subsample of participants wore a SenseDoc device for 10 days during May 2017-January 2019 to record GPS and accelerometry data. Two physical activity outcomes were derived from SenseDoc data: time spent in light, moderate, and vigorous physical activity; and time spent in moderate or vigorous physical activity. Using corresponding GPS coordinates, we summarized physical activity outcomes by dissemination area-a Canadian census geography that represents areas where 400 to 700 people live- and joined to built (active living space, proximity to amenities, and urban compactness) and gentrification measures. We examined the associations between environmental measures and physical activity outcomes using multi-level negative binomial regression models that were stratified by city and adjusted for covariates (weekday/weekend), home dissemination area, precipitation, temperature) and participant-level characteristics obtained from a survey (age, gender, income, race). RESULTS: We found that adults spent more time being physically active near their homes, and in environments that were more walkable and near parks and less time in urban compact areas, regardless of where participants lived. Our analysis also highlighted how proximity to different amenities was linked to physical activity across different cities. CONCLUSIONS: Our study provides insights into how built environment and gentrification characteristics are associated with the amount of time adults spend being physically active in four Canadian cities. These findings enhance our understanding of the influence that environments have on physical activity over time and space, and can support policies to increase physical activity.

BACKGROUND: Walkability is a popular term used to describe aspects of the built and social environment that have important population-level impacts on physical activity, energy balance, and health. Although the term is widely used by researchers, practitioners, and the general public, and multiple operational definitions and walkability measurement tools exist, there are is no agreed-upon conceptual definition of walkability. METHOD: To address this gap, researchers from Memorial University of Newfoundland hosted "The Future of Walkability Measures Workshop" in association with researchers from the Canadian Urban Environmental Health Research Consortium (CANUE) in November 2017. During the workshop, trainees, researchers, and practitioners worked together in small groups to iteratively develop and reach consensus about a conceptual definition and name for walkability. The objective of this paper was to discuss and propose a conceptual definition of walkability and related concepts. RESULTS: In discussions during the workshop, it became clear that the term walkability leads to a narrow conception of the environmental features associated with health as it inherently focuses on walking. As a result, we suggest that the term Active Living Environments, as has been previously proposed in the literature, are more appropriate. We define Active Living Environments (ALEs) as the emergent natural, built, and social properties of neighbourhoods that promote physical activity and health and allow for equitable access to health-enhancing resources. CONCLUSIONS: We believe that this broader conceptualization allows for a more comprehensive understanding of how built, natural, and social environments can contribute to improved health for all members of the population.
